diff --git a/Source/CAVEOverlay/Private/CAVEOverlayController.cpp b/Source/CAVEOverlay/Private/CAVEOverlayController.cpp
index a28b0e50ad5bb81829b0203d6751fb5d40b1d5fe..37251ceac528125687a8101521c5de3951facc81 100644
--- a/Source/CAVEOverlay/Private/CAVEOverlayController.cpp
+++ b/Source/CAVEOverlay/Private/CAVEOverlayController.cpp
@@ -156,8 +156,9 @@ void ACAVEOverlayController::HandleClusterEvent(const FDisplayClusterClusterEven
 	}
 }
 
-void ACAVEOverlayController::SetDoorMode(EDoor_Mode M)
+void ACAVEOverlayController::SetDoorMode(EDoor_Mode NewMode)
 {
+	Door_Current_Mode = NewMode;
 	switch (Door_Current_Mode)
 	{
 	case EDoor_Mode::DOOR_DEBUG: